It’s hard to believe that three years have already passed since the Madden series has faced any competition on the field. With the exclusive license to the NFL and NFLPA, EA’s Madden series effectively chased out any competition. EA’s once biggest competitor, 2K Sports, has returned with All-Pro Football 2K8. Instead of using official teams and current licenses, 2K brought in historical legends into one game.
Instead of setting the legends on teams to start the game, All-Pro Football 2K8 forces users to select a team of 11 stars, with the rest of the team filled out with average CPU generated players. Your 11 choices are limited to two gold stars, three silver stars, and six bronze stars. As indicated, the players are divided up according to star level.
